					<description><![CDATA[As expected, state insurance regulators have issued a final order jacking up the price of worker&#8217;s compensation insurance by nearly 15 percent. The order was published Thursday. The decision approves the National Council on Compensation Insurance (NCCI) request &#8220;for an overall combined statewide average rate increase of 14.5 percent,&#8221; the Office of Insurance Regulation said in a press release.
